Fired Indian IT workers turn to chatbots for counselling


That’s why many are embracing the convenience, anonymity and affordability of online counselling start-ups, most of which use human therapists. Help is available 24/7, and the start-up currently offers over 2,000 counselling sessions daily. When a relative suggested he seek help through an online counselling service called the Juno Clinic, he demurred. Its online chats are free while users are charged for audio and video chats. After seven Rs800-an-hour counselling sessions via phone calls and Skype video, the engineer finally landed a job six weeks ago.
